WebThe average amount of energy transferred from one trophic level to the next is 10%. For example, 10% of the solar energy that is captured by phytoplankton gets passed on to zooplankton (primary consumers). In simple models with a dozen or so state variables (e.g. biogeochemical NPZ models), a clean, visually-intuitive diagram can be constructed manually without too much effort. east port galleyWebA food web consists of many food chains. A food chain only follows just one path as animals find food. eg: A hawk eats a snake, which has eaten a frog, which has eaten a grasshopper, which has eaten grass. A food web shows the many different paths plants and animals are connected. eg: A hawk might also eat a mouse, a squirrel, a frog or some ... east portland ctcWeb30 nov. 2024 · Food Chain.
